## Configuration

FormulaCage evaluates user-supplied formulas inside the Nettlewick sandbox. Set `FC_TIMEOUT_MS` (default 500) and `FC_MAX_DEPTH` (default 32) in `.env`. Never run the evaluator with sandboxing disabled outside local dev. The sandbox broker authenticates the evaluator with a signing secret, which must be the next line in the env file:

sealed setting: RELAY_SECRET5=82864

**Q: How do I recover the Larkspan metrics sidecar if its credential cache is wiped?**

The sidecar (deployed alongside every Quillgate service pod) stores scrape tokens in an encrypted local cache. After a node rebuild, the cache is empty and aggregation silently stalls, so check the flush counter first. To re-seed, run the sidecar's recover subcommand and supply the team recovery passphrase when prompted. For the weekly sync's reference, the current passphrase is recorded immediately below this entry.

strongbox words: zoreth-fraox-oliius-aldeth-jorax-praeth-holmir-drumir-prawyn

## Step 2: Enable the large-file diff viewer

Ledgerlens 5.0 replaces the in-memory diff renderer with a streaming viewer, lifting the previous 50 MB cap. Before rollout, the release manager should purge cached diffs from the old renderer, as they are incompatible with the streaming format. Once the cache is cleared, restart the viewer service with the configuration values below.

settings of tagef-bawif:
DRUIX_HOST=druix.zemvarlabs.internal
DRUIX_PORT=8000

Onboarding note for the Ledgerpane admin table: bulk edits are applied through the batcher service, not directly against the database. Select rows, choose an action, and the batcher stages changes in a pending set you can review before commit. Edits over 500 rows require a second approver — this is enforced server-side, so don't try to chunk around it. To run the batcher locally you need the staging write credential, which goes in your .env as the next line.

secret setting of bahip-kagag: RELAY_SECRET3=c83